Output 80bf1c78f66df972bc3bb3275da5d77fcb052fa86c7991c337b4bd5d3b30fb61:2

value
5114600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c1a8ddd0bccd8f2e6d6e01834a3e6be47a2911b OP_EQUALVERIFY OP_CHECKSIG
address
1M4oUDdEa6VNn9SsEQVbZ5B6m5kWUborQa
transaction
80bf1c78f66df972bc3bb3275da5d77fcb052fa86c7991c337b4bd5d3b30fb61
confirmations
306374
spent
true